Project Description
The project involves the rehabilitation of the Federation and Oxford bridges, as well as the reconstruction of the 1 km of dual carriageway between Rockridge road and Federation road.

In addition, the entire 3 km existing stormwater drainage system will be replaced between Rockridge bridge and Federation road bridge on the freeway, as well as on Oxford and Federation roads below the freeway.

Latest Developments
The construction upgrades on the M1 freeway’s Oxford and Federation bridges will enter the third and final phase in May.

The project is 75% complete, with the majority of fill and stabilisation of underground conditions completed on the southbound section.

The application of protective coatings is also under way and work will now progress to the northbound section of the M1, necessitating a switchover of lanes.

As from the start of May, two lanes of the M1 will be open in each direction, while the Ettrick road onramp (southbound) will reopen and the Oxford road offramp (northbound) will close.
